3.1.2 OSD Function Introduction 1. Gaming This function contains seven sub-functions that you can select for your preference. Gaming Overclocking Variable OD AMD FreeSync Premium ELMB GamePlus GameVisual Shadow Boost ASUS TUF Gaming VG248Q1B Racing Mode HDMI-1 1080p 60Hz • Overclocking: This function allows you to adjust the refresh rate. • Variable OD: The adjusting range is from level 0 to level 5.The default setting is level 3. • AMD FreeSync Premium : It can allow a AMD FreeSync Premium supported graphics source to dynamically adjust display refresh rate based on typical content frame rates for power efficient, virtually stutter free and low-latency display update. • ELMB: Check to decrease motion blur and minimize ghosting part when on-screen objects are fast moving. • GamePlus: Activate Crosshair, Timer or FPS Counter or Display Alignment function. • GameVisual: This function contains seven sub-functions that you can select for your preference. • Shadow Boost:Dark color enhancement adjust monitor gamma curve to enrich the dark tones in an image making dark scenes and objects much easier be found. • In the Racing Mode, the Saturation, and ASCR functions are not userconfigurable. • In the sRGB Mode, the Saturation, Skin Tone, Color Temp., Brightness, Contrast and ASCR functions are not user-configurable. • In the MOBA Mode, the Saturation and ASCR functions are not userconfigurable. 3-2 Chapter 3: General Instruction
